Micromax Canvas Mega Review & Pros And Cons

Picture of the Micromax Canvas Mega, by Micromax

- Analysis by KJ David


This Micromax model's name (mega) is probably a nod to its 2820mAh battery , which even though isn't overwhelming, is still a pro for a phone with no LTE capability and an HD-only (1280 x 720) 5.5-inch display -- the latter coming with Gorilla Glass 3 protection, though. In addition, we caught a con in the form of its 1GB RAM , as it is obviously not a desirable match for its 1.4GHz eight-core processor . Along with 13- and 5-megapixel cameras , Micromax also loads it with a familiar combo of apps, including Chaatz, Amazon Shopping, and Clean Master.

It might not be the mega Android that its name suggests, but the Micromax Canvas Mega (E353) is not without a few appreciable features.
